I Got Rhythm, Melodic Analysis
Q: How do I stop playing a melody as a bunch of notes and make it sound musical?
Focus on identifying and shaping musical phrases rather than individual notes; listen for breath points, pauses, and resolutions, and practice singing the phrases to connect notes and maintain legato. Emphasize phrase-level thinking over note-by-note execution, and remember that expressing phrases with space and rhythm creates musicality.
I Got Rhythm, Harmonic Analysis
Q: And Carlotta, this question is simply this. I'm always hearing jazz educators say that I need to spend a lot of time listening to jazz. But no one ever explains what I should actually be listening for.
Listen in two stages—start with macro listening to identify style, form, tempo, ensemble, and instrumentation, then apply micro listening to analyze sounds, chord shapes, arpeggio and scale movements, and rhythmic motifs, all through the lens of the seven facts of music.
Sweet Lorraine, Solo Piano
Q: Is there a right way to approach the left hand when playing solo piano?
There isn't one correct method; start with one voicing type, lock in time, and gradually add harmonic neighbors and motion to create clean, intentional accompaniment that supports the melody.
Sweet Lorraine, Melodic Analysis
Q: How do you know where the phrases actually are in a jazz melody?
Identify the phrase boundaries by listening for natural breaths in four-bar segments, determine entry and destination notes, and treat peaks as target notes to shape the melody and give it direction.
Sweet Lorraine, Improvisation
Q: Hey Dr. Lawrence, how do I practice improvisation in a way that is structured and actually helps me get better?
The host explains that improvisation should be approached with clear constraints and a prepared foundation: practice time and one as a reference point, then build melodic, harmonic, and rhythmic ideas around the third as a central anchor, while avoiding noodling by maintaining intentional exploration.

Frequently Asked Questions About Jazz Piano Skills

What is Jazz Piano Skills about and what kind of topics does it cover?

Content is centered around educating aspiring jazz pianists, focusing on key skills like improvisation, harmonic analysis, and melodic understanding. Each episode explores a classic jazz tune, providing a structured approach to mastering the piano through a blend of theory and practical application. Unique aspects include a strong emphasis on a systematic learning model, where foundational elements are prioritized, encouraging listeners to develop a deep connection with music. With engaging Q&A segments and personalized tips, the podcast aims to foster both technical skills and emotional expression in jazz performance.
